The award is a nationally recognised award that helps young people over the age of 14 develop their leadership skills. It’s a fun course and offers an insight into the enjoyment one can gain through sports leadership.

tutor with groupThe syllabus fosters generic skills, which can be applied to a variety of different sporting activities as well as contributing to the participants personal and social education. It’s a practical qualification where candidates learn through doing, rather than through written work. A candidates ability as a competent leader is assessed by observation rather than written tests.

The award is a fantastic way of delivering elements of the Physical Education National Curriculum at Key Stage 4. As well as this, the generic aspects of leadership taught by the Award complement many of the Governments objectives of the Citizenship N.C. requirements. These include: Developing skills for enquiry and communication and Developing skills for participation and responsible action. PSHE elements include: Developing confidence and responsibility; Developing a healthier, safer lifestyle; Developing good relationships and respecting the differences between people.

blue bullet Unit 01 - Planning, preparing and assisting a simple sporting activity

blue bullet Unit 02 - Basic communication skills for leading a sporting activity

blue bullet Unit 03 - Principles / practice in delivering a basic health / fitness session

blue bullet Unit 04 - Understanding fair play in sport

blue bullet Unit 05 - Understanding the role of the sports official

blue bullet Unit 06 - Understanding the scope of local sport and recreation activities

blue bullet Unit 07 - Demonstration of leadership skills in sport
